Output b68a51bf3402624fcaaedbf233e4494f8849baec368fb76e0b1c50cf38de1bb9:18

value
13631
script pubkey
OP_0 OP_PUSHBYTES_20 be2b80ff27e2c1a3ad7902455acb3ad1151ab47e
address
bc1qhc4cple8utq68tteqfz44je66y234dr76n966r
transaction
b68a51bf3402624fcaaedbf233e4494f8849baec368fb76e0b1c50cf38de1bb9
confirmations
97664
spent
true